Conor Benn v Peter Dobson
Peter Dobson has always wanted a big-time opportunity, but after waiting around for years, the old veteran began losing hope. But, just when ring rust was forming and inactivity was becoming the norm, Dobson (16-0, 9 KOs) was thrown a lifeline.
On February 3rd, the 33-year-old will officially return to the ring when he takes on Conor Benn in Las Vegas, Nevada. A world title won’t be on the line but the British star will be the best fighter Dobson has ever faced...at least on paper.
Although Dobson’s undefeated record gives him a bit of credibility, oddsmakers aren’t giving him much of a chance at pulling off the upset. Curious to find out what the betting public thinks of him, Dobson took a look. Once he did, he couldn’t believe it.
In some places, Dobson is as high as a six-to-one underdog. Essentially, Dobson believes he’s being viewed flippantly. But, instead of arguing with whoever decided to put him as an underdog, he’s simply telling all of his close friends and family members to run to the nearest ATM they can find and throw their life savings on him come fight night.
“If you wanna win some bread (money), bet on me for February 3rd,” said Dobson on a self-recorded video. “Conor Benn is a bum and they got him beating me on the odds in Vegas.”
Benn, 27, spent over a year attempting to clear his name after failing a pre-fight PED test. He hasn’t been fully exonerated but Benn (22-0, 14 KOs) is moving forward with his career.
When taking a look at the names he’s beaten and the overall skills he’s shown, Dobson doesn't understand the hype surrounding him. Simply talking about what he’ll do, however, won’t get him anywhere. So instead, Dobson plans on showing the rest of the world why he’s on another level.
“The kid is a bum. I don’t know how they think he can beat me.”

Conor Benn says he is willing to "fight to the death to prove his innocence" after a provisional doping suspension in 2022.
The 27-year-old failed two Voluntary Anti-Doping Association tests before his cancelled bout with Chris Eubank Jr in October 2022.
He tested positive for female fertility drug clomifene, but has always denied intentionally taking it.
Benn does not hold a boxing licence in the UK.
"I'm willing to spend every last penny I have and fight to the death to prove my innocence," he told ITV's Good Morning Britain.
"My name matters more to me than anything else, fighting is fighting, but your name stands forever and so for me it's been hard, it's been challenging, but I've got a good team around me."
Clomifene can be used to boost testosterone levels in men and is banned inside and outside competition by the World Anti-Doping Agency.
Benn's last fight in the UK was in April 2022. In September he returned to the ring, fighting under a US licence when he defeated Rodolfo Orozco in Florida.
"There's many things in my life I've gone through, this is probably one of the worst things. I wouldn't wish this upon my worst enemy," he added.
Benn fights in the United States on 3 February when he faces American Peter Dobson in Las Vegas.
In March 2023, UK Anti-Doping (Ukad) provisionally suspended Benn but the National Anti-Doping Panel lifted the suspension in July after a hearing.
Ukad and the British Boxing Board of Control have appealed against that decision.
Benn, who has won all 22 of his professional bouts, is scheduled to fight Peter Dobson on 3 February in Las Vegas.

I'm not sure why this fellah keeps getting exposure. all the ususal soundbites about wanting to clear his name, yet he hasn't produced one shred of evidence to back up his protests of innocence.
he has been given many opportunities to do so, yet still has given nothing.
the stupid thing was , that if he done a plea bargaining , taken a small ban , he would have had his licence back already .
Canelo, Fury and loads more have taken their rap on the knuckles and moved on with no lasting damage.
His problem is because he has protested so much , people are smelling a rat , and the more evasive he is, the more people sense something untoward.
he's made some terrible calls.
